Silent Authentication: Security Without the Friction

One of the most exciting aspects of this expanded collaboration is the integration of Silent Authentication. Unlike traditional two-factor authentication that requires manual input, Silent Authentication verifies users in the background, reducing friction while maintaining security.

Think of it as a digital bouncer who knows your face and lets you in without asking for your ID every single time. It’s seamless, invisible, and secure.

For enterprises, this means fewer abandoned logins and smoother customer experiences. For readers, it means less hassle when accessing apps or services. And let’s be honest—nobody enjoys typing in OTPs every five minutes.

Colocation at VITRO Clark: Redundancy and Reliability

The partnership also extends to colocation services at VITRO Clark, one of PLDT’s most advanced data centers. This isn’t just about having extra servers. It’s about scalability, redundancy, and disaster resilience.

By hosting critical infrastructure in VITRO Clark, Synermaxx ensures that its messaging services remain online even during unexpected outages. For industries like finance, healthcare, and logistics, downtime isn’t just inconvenient—it’s costly.

Synermaxx: A Pioneer in ICT Solutions

Founded in 2004, Synermaxx Corporation has been at the forefront of integrated ICT solutions in the Philippines. Its services span software, internet, mobile, and hardware, supporting industries from finance and healthcare to logistics, retail, and education.

This breadth of expertise is what makes the partnership with PLDT Enterprise so effective. Synermaxx brings agility and innovation, while PLDT provides the infrastructure and scale.
